Definition
Noun: 1. A physical collection of recorded music: A set of one or more audio recordings (such as songs) issued together as a single commercial product, originally on phonograph records and later on formats like cassette tapes or compact discs (CDs). The term often implies the complete packaged product, including its cover art and liner notes. 2. The physical object itself: The medium (e.g., a vinyl disc, cassette, or CD) or the packaged set containing the audio recordings.

Advanced Usage
- "Concept album": An album where all the songs contribute to a single overarching theme or story.
- "The Wall" by Pink Floyd is a famous concept album.
- "Album-oriented rock (AOR)": A radio format that focuses on playing tracks from full record albums, rather than just singles.
Variants and Related Words
- Album (n): A common shortened form of "record album." Can also refer to a book for collecting photographs or stamps.
- I bought the new Taylor Swift album.
- LP (Long Play) (n): Specifically refers to a 12-inch vinyl record album designed to be played at 33⅓ revolutions per minute.
- Studio album (n): An album consisting primarily of new, original recordings made in a studio, as opposed to a live or compilation album.
